I dyed my hair brown and i want to get it back to my natural hair color which is blonde!! how do i do that?

The easiest solution would be to go to the salon! of course you can do it yourself if you'd rather...keep in mind you will need to use lots of conditioner on your hair after you do this. the first thing you will need is a hair lightening kit. you can get them at most department stores...this is going to strip your hair of all color...and if you do it right, it will be the color of a lemon. after you do this, dye your hair back to its original shade of blonde. don't leave any of these products in your hair longer than it says to...they can be very very damaging because they dry your hair out alot.

I dyed my hair brown and i want to get it back to my natural hair color which is blonde!! how do i do that?

The trick to your dilemma is the word "natural". The obvious answer is seek a professional. This can be a long process and can be very damaging to your hair if you do not know how to do it. In my professional opinion one color never looks natural. All hair has some variance in the levels and tone. You are going to have to gently remove the brown pigment and then create several slightly different levels and tones of blonds through highlighting and toning. Like I said, not for an untrained person. This is your hair sister, you wear it everyday with every outfit. Don't take any more chances.
